hi, I have a crown RR3020-45 Ser# 1A147590
The sequence switch on the joystick intermittently does not switch any hydraulic function, and I believe it is a broken wire in the base of the joystick. If I replace the joystick How do I calibrate it? or does it have to be calibrated? Or has anyone ever had other problems related to this?

You have a wire or switch bad. They can both be changed and there is no calibrating those.
